Primary Arms Releases PLx Compact 1-8x with ACSS Raptor Reticle

Primary Arms introduced the PLx Compact 1-8×24 FFP rifle scope featuring the ACSS Raptor 5.56/.308 Meter G2 reticle. Field testing confirms the optic delivers clear glass and reliable operation across duty, hunting, and competitive applications. The compact design targets shooters who need variable magnification without adding bulk to modern rifle platforms.

Key Details

  • Magnification range: 1-8x with first-focal-plane (FFP) reticle design
  • Objective lens: 24mm, keeping overall length and weight minimal
  • Reticle: ACSS Raptor 5.56/.308 Meter G2 — calibrated for both intermediate and full-power rifle cartridges
  • Proven reliability in duty and competitive environments
  • Price point positions it as accessible mid-range optic without premium brand markup

Why It Matters for Gun Owners

The 1-8x power range solves a real problem: shooters carrying modern AR-pattern rifles want precision at distance without sacrificing close-quarters speed. The FFP reticle means holdover marks work correctly at any magnification — critical for fast target transitions. The compact 24mm objective keeps overall footprint low, making it ideal for rifles running suppressors, offset optics, or thermal mounts. Gun owners running 5.56 NATO or .308 Winchester get a caliber-specific reticle without paying the tax that premium brands like Nightforce or Leupold demand. At sub-$500, this scope fills the gap between budget Chinese optics and five-figure Euro glass.
